Crunchy Chopped Salad Recipe

Gluten free, dairy free, vegetarian, naturally sweetened

Ingredients: Makes 4-6 servings

  • 2 cups cauliflower, chopped
  • 2 cups broccoli, chopped
  • 1 cup red cabbage, roughly chopped
  • 1 cup carrots, roughly chopped
  • 1/2 to 1 cup fresh parsley
  • 2 celery stalks, chopped
  • 1/2 cup almonds
  • 1/2 cup sunflower seeds
  • Optional: add fruit like grapes or berries for crunch

Vinaigrette:

  • 1/2 cup lemon juice
  • 1 tbsp fresh ginger, peeled and grated
  • 2 tbsp honey
  • 1/2 tsp sea salt
  • For best results refrigerate at least 1 hour before use

How to Make:

  1. Place ingredients for vinaigrette in a jar with a lid and shake the ingredients.  Refrigerate for 1 hour.
  2. Place salad ingredients individually into a food processor and quickly process until they’re finely copped.
  3. Combine all ingredients in a large bowl.
  4. Toss the vinaigrette into the chopped vegetables.crunchy-chopped-salad-recipe
